> I'm running a Surface Pro.  All Jaws functions that I use are working as
> expected.  Windows crashes on occasion, but the fact that Jaws 16
re-starts
> is a major step forward when this occurs.  I have had to do a few Jaws
> repairs and had some other issues with Office 365, but overall, I'm very
> pleased with the Surface.  I find that a Bluetooth keyboard is preferable
> over using the surface's keyboard cover.  Howevewr, when I need to charge
> the keyboard, the cover is better than not having a keyboard to use.
